awesome-webext-dev
github.com/davestewart/awesome-webext-dev ↗List of resources for web extension development
Use this list with your AI agent
Add the Context Awesome MCP server to Claude, Cursor, or any MCP client, then ask:
"Show me learning resources from awesome-webext-dev"
Installation instructions →What's inside
Learning
- automa
A browser extension for automating your browser by connecting blocks
- awesome-browser-extensions-for-github
60+ GitHub extensions with links to source code
- Chrome docs
- Chrome Extensions Samples
- Chromium Extensions
Google Group
- Firefox Extension Workshop
Get help creating & publishing Firefox extensions
Community
Services
- Chrome Extension Source Viewer
View Chrome Web store extension source without installing
- Chromium Bug Tracker
- Chromium Extensions Design Documents
- Chromium Source Code
Packages
- extension-bus
Universal message bus for chromium and firefox browsers
- lit
simple library for building fast, lightweight web components
- mutation-summary
A JavaScript library that makes observing changes to the DOM easy
- shadow-dom-in-depth
Everything you need to know about Shadow DOM
- Shoelace
A forward-thinking library of web components.
- trpc-chrome
tRPC adapter for Web Extensions
Tooling
- extension-create
Create cross-browser extensions with no build configuration
- InboxSDK
A JavaScript library for building apps inside of Gmail with browser extensions
- plasmo
helps you build, test, and deploy browser extensions
- Plasmo BPP
A GitHub action to publish your browser extension to every web store/add-ons marketplace
- vitesse-webext
A Vite-powered (HMR), cross-browser starter template built on Vitesse
- webextension-toolbox
Small CLI toolbox for cross-browser WebExtension development
Showing a sample of 43 resources. View the full list on GitHub →